Meeting began @ 3pm. Live English and Spanish interpretations are available for this zoom meeting.
The purpose of this meeting is to review a grant given by the EPA to clean up a brownfield (contaminated abandoned industrial site) @ 3250 S Kedzie.
Presentation will be given by an urban planner from Chicago Southwest Development Co. It will cover what was discovered at the site, how to apply, and what the next steps could be. https://t.co/m70Me3V13w
There are more than 1000 brownfields in Chicago, most located within communities that have high rates of unemployment, poverty, chronic illnesses, & other socioeconomic challenges.
Picture of proposed focal point site. https://t.co/ozINs1S0Vj
Previous uses of this site included steel production, diesel repair, scrap metals, auto mechanics, parking, and recycling site.
Environmental Assessment on site as a result of previous uses. Contaminates found need to be addressed before site is developed. https://t.co/hwltFkqXwv
Possible alternatives that were suggested by environmental consults included these 3 options. Alternative 3 was the most recommended. https://t.co/fLRTDPlIHM
If application is approved, awards would be given in the spring. After that, any necessary additional steps required by the EPA would need to be completed. Grant timeline is about 3 years, however the org. is hoping to start much sooner.
